Well guys, I have now got the RPG front end on it including UCA, LCA, and tie rods. I got all the other stuff from ford (CV axles, brake lines) and the front end is complete. I used a set of raptor take off shocks front and rear, put a raptor steering wheel on it, and have a lead on a raptor rear axle as well. ADD in phoenix has my front/rear take off bumpers and stock skid. EBay has the hood and grill but I have not ordered yet. Picked up front fenders/liners/flares from a forum member in PHX this past week. I still need raptor front seats and a bed but I will most likely end up doing fiberglass rear bedsides. Yes it will not be a "true" raptor by vin, but everything else will be but the motor. You can call it lame all you want but talk to anyone who has one (SDHQ) and they will tell you it is a far better truck. All I have is a superchips programmer with a canned tune and tire size corrections and I can pull 4 truck lengths on my friends raptor 0-60. My tires are only 33" now so I realize that is a factor. Call Livernois and see what kind of HP $2500 will get you in an ecoboost, then go look up superchargers for the 6.2. I am not baggin raptors as I owned one too. They are the baddest truck built. I just prefer more power and better mileage. I just checked my mileage yesterday with all the suspension etc on, 18.4 mpg. We will see what it will do when I am done but SDHQ gets 18 with theirs. Thus truck should keep me happy till the new raptors come out and we all go buy new ones. I sure hope the twin turbo coyote motor makes it to the raptor.

I don't think anyone will dispute that an Ecoboost could perform, the reason I personally wouldn't want one is because to me, it over complicates things. A turbo setup is just added heat and another system that can go down on you. With the 6.2 it's just a motor, sure it can still shit on you, but it's less likely given the simplicity.
